The Church of the Brethren, also known as Brethren churches, has existed as a group for over three hundred years. The goal of this Christian church is to simply do what Jesus did while he was here on earth. Members of the Church of the Brethren have the goal in mind to practice peaceful living by listening conscientiously, seeking guidance in the scriptures, and working toward reconciliation. Whether worshiping, serving, learning, or celebrating, Brethren act in community. Together, we study the Bible to discern God's will; we make decisions as a group, and each person's voice matters.
